Майкрофт на рабочем столе. Как?

13

После просмотра новостей о том, что Майкрофт работает в моем любимом дистрибутиве, распространяется снова и снова и, увидев его в действии на настольной системе , я решил, что хочу его.

Я пытался найти его snap find, но его там нет

[...]
mongo33                    3.3.9                      niemeyer              -        MongoDB document-oriented database
morse-converter-py         1-3                        brunonova             -        Simple command-line Morse converter
mup-accounts               2016.07.01                 niemeyer              -        mup IRC and Telegram bot - account connection side
mup-plugins                2016.07.05                 niemeyer              -        mup IRC and Telegram bot - plugins side
nethack                    3.4.2-2                    ogra                  -        The popular nethack console adventure
nextcloud                  9.0.50snap3                canonical             -        Nextcloud Server
[...]

Итак ... Где я могу найти его и как мне его установить? :)

dadexix86
источник
На самом деле, похоже, его нет в магазине Ubuntu. Это может быть вопрос для людей Майкрофта. Возможно, что снимки все еще находятся в разработке.
Кайл

Ответы:

8

Я очень рад, что вы интересуетесь Майкрофтом, и как часть команды я хотел бы пригласить вас и всех присутствующих здесь присоединиться к нашим основным каналам связи (это облегчает сотрудничество).

Вы можете скачать наш исходный код, добавить вопросы, обсудить будущее и внести свой вклад, если хотите, в нашем репозитории Github .

Некоторую полезную документацию по настройке среды разработки, а также по созданию навыков можно найти здесь:

И наконец, чтобы учесть тот факт, что Майкрофта еще нет в магазине моментальных снимков, это правильно. Однако я работаю над этим здесь: https://github.com/MycroftAI/snapcraft-mycroft-core

Как только я смогу заставить его работать до приемлемого уровня, я буду загружать его на панель запуска.

Кроме того, это snapcraft.yamlзависит от некоторых модификаций, которые я сделал mycroft-core, которые можно найти в этой ветке .

На данный момент основные функции работают только в devmode, что означает отсутствие ограничений. Кроме того, у меня проблема с pocketsphinx, что означает, что только клиент Cli работает из коробки. Я очень хотел бы любую помощь или обратную связь, которую вы могли бы дать мне!

Если вы предпочитаете apt-get install mycroft-core, у меня тоже есть решение.

aatchison
источник
Здравствуй! Спасибо, что ответили :) КАК МОЖНО СКОРЕЕ Я пройду твою инструкцию и попробую все настроить. Если у вас есть свободное время и вы хотите поделиться с вами тем, как настроить apt-getдеталь, я думаю, что это может быть очень полезно для сообщества :)
dadexix86
По-прежнему недоступен в качестве оснастки, и связанный репозиторий не обновлялся в течение 10 месяцев. Я не думаю, что Майкрофт настолько серьезно относится к рабочему столу. Это, конечно, сработало как маркетинговая вещь, потому что многие люди смотрели видео с рабочего стола mycroft.
трампстер
1
Боюсь, что разработка моментальных пакетов довольно устарела, и еще многое предстоит сделать. Мы также работаем над репозиторием панели запуска. Рабочий стол жив и здоров! Есть плазмоид KDE, а также действительно хорошая оболочка гнома, которые довольно далеко друг от друга.
Aatchison
0

Простая установка в Ubuntu & Debian с https://docs.mycroft.ai/install.and.running/installation/apt-get.install

sudo apt-get install apt-transport-https
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ys F3B1AA8B
sudo bash -c 'echo "deb http://repo.mycroft.ai/repos/apt/debian debian main" > /etc/apt/sources.list.d/repo.mycroft.ai.list'
sudo apt-get update
sudo apt-get install mycroft-core

Следующее установлено:

mycroft-messagebus
mycroft-skills
mycroft-speech-client

Старт и Стоп, как:

service mycroft-messagebus start
service mycroft-messagebus stop
ЭДИ
источник
эта ссылка мертва
трампстер
0

Установка и запуск mycroft на рабочем столе Ubuntu возможны, однако ограничены и без полной совместимости навыков из-за проблем с питоном. Особенно относится к различным версиям Python и urllib, что является препятствием для получения различных навыков в зависимости от этого.

Однако не все потеряно из-за https://git.covolunablu.org/portaloffreedom/mycroft-core-PKGBUILD, который является попыткой решить такие проблемы. Любой, кто может понять, как его применить и собрать с его помощью, может иметь исправленный mycroft, работающий на рабочем столе Debian / Ubuntu.

Мне еще предстоит разобраться в этом самому, и все еще надеемся увидеть хороший пакет Ubuntu, полностью исправленный и с рабочими навыками. В большинстве случаев проблемы с питоном могут быть потенциально решены или решены с помощью отдельного инструмента для систем Debian / Ubuntu для обработки и исправления различных проектов, портирующих их для работы, возможно, части инструментов autoconf или чего-то подобного.

При попытке вручную установить и собрать mycroft на моем рабочем столе, установка будет повреждена и иногда даже не будет работать должным образом, требуя полной очистки и переустановки, включая различные папки с навыками и конфигурационные папки. Не что-то простое и легкое для всех, возможно, Ubuntu испортил многих из нас в последние годы. Похоже, что это должно создать больше для тестирования и использования в системах Ubuntu.

Тем не менее, когда это работает, и навыки, которые совместимы до сих пор, кажется, работают достаточно хорошо, это довольно впечатляющий проект, требующий дополнительных инвестиций, времени, денег и тому подобного.

sj0gmail
источник